在当今的互联网时代,Java Server Pages(JSP)技术作为Web开发中的一种重要技术,已经广泛应用于各种大型项目中。而韩顺平老师作为国内知名的Java讲师,他的JSP项目课件实例无疑是学习JSP技术的重要参考资料。本文将围绕韩顺平老师的JSP项目课件实例,为大家带来实战解析与学习指南。
一、韩顺平JSP项目课件实例概述

韩顺平老师的JSP项目课件实例主要针对初学者,通过一系列实际项目案例,帮助学员掌握JSP技术的核心概念和开发技巧。课件内容丰富,包括项目需求分析、技术选型、数据库设计、前端界面设计、后端逻辑处理等方面。
二、课件实例实战解析
1. 项目需求分析
在项目开发过程中,需求分析是至关重要的环节。以下是一个简单的例子:
项目需求:开发一个在线图书管理系统,包括图书查询、借阅、归还等功能。
分析:
- 图书查询:支持按书名、作者、出版社等条件进行查询。
- 借阅:用户可在线借阅图书,系统自动记录借阅信息。
- 归还:用户可在线归还图书,系统自动更新借阅信息。
2. 技术选型
在项目开发过程中,技术选型至关重要。以下是一个技术选型示例:
- 前端技术:HTML、CSS、JavaScript、jQuery。
- 后端技术:Java、Servlet、JSP、JDBC。
- 数据库:MySQL。
3. 数据库设计
数据库设计是项目开发的基础。以下是一个简单的数据库设计示例:
| 表名 | 字段 | 类型 | 说明 |
|---|---|---|---|
| books | id | int | 图书ID |
| user | id | int | 用户ID |
| borrow | id | int | 借阅ID |
| book_info | id | int | 图书信息ID |
| user_info | id | int | 用户信息ID |
4. 前端界面设计
前端界面设计是用户与系统交互的重要环节。以下是一个前端界面设计示例:
- 图书查询:用户输入查询条件,点击查询按钮,显示查询结果。
- 借阅:用户选择图书,点击借阅按钮,弹出借阅确认对话框。
- 归还:用户选择图书,点击归还按钮,弹出归还确认对话框。
5. 后端逻辑处理
后端逻辑处理是项目开发的核心。以下是一个后端逻辑处理示例:
- 图书查询:根据用户输入的查询条件,查询数据库,返回查询结果。
- 借阅:判断图书是否可借,若可借,更新数据库,记录借阅信息。
- 归还:更新数据库,记录归还信息。
三、学习指南
1. 基础知识
在学习韩顺平老师的JSP项目课件实例之前,建议先掌握以下基础知识:
- Java语言基础
- HTML、CSS、JavaScript、jQuery
- MySQL数据库
2. 项目实践
在学习过程中,建议多动手实践。以下是一些建议:
- 按照课件实例,逐步完成项目开发。
- 遇到问题,查阅资料或请教他人。
- 模仿其他优秀项目,提升自己的开发能力。
3. 总结与反思
在学习过程中,要善于总结与反思。以下是一些建议:
- 定期回顾所学知识,巩固记忆。
- 分析项目开发过程中的问题,总结经验教训。
- 思考如何将所学知识应用于实际工作中。
韩顺平老师的JSP项目课件实例为初学者提供了丰富的实战案例,通过学习这些案例,我们可以掌握JSP技术的核心概念和开发技巧。在学习过程中,我们要注重基础知识的学习,多动手实践,善于总结与反思,不断提升自己的开发能力。希望本文能对大家的学习有所帮助。





